Q: How do we re-run the contrast audit after a palette change?

A: The Lanternfish audit pipeline checks every component token against WCAG-style thresholds we defined internally. Run the audit job from the design-systems workspace; results land in the accessibility dashboard. If the dashboard shows stale results, the snapshot store may need to be unlocked — this happens after token rotations. Future maintainers should record any unlock in the audit log. The snapshot store accepts the recovery passphrase noted directly below.

unlock words, yawig-kagef: gordor-holvan-ulaael-pramir-ulaiel-tamdor

### Step 2: Apply drift correction

Support: after migrating a Thornmere greenhouse controller, customers may report temperature readings drifting upward over 48 hours. This is expected until the correction table is reloaded. Ask them to power-cycle once, then trigger a recalibration from the panel. Confirm their unit is running the post-migration settings, listed below.

service settings:
[pelius]
port = 5432
team = praius
host = pelius.crelvoforge.internal
region = upper-4
access_code = ac_8f224d
timeout_ms = 2000

DeployPing is our little chat bot that answers "is the deploy done yet?" so you don't have to ping the platform team. Hit the /status endpoint with a release channel name and it replies with the current stage, who kicked it off, and any blocking checks. Support folks mostly use the /history endpoint when customers report weirdness after a rollout. All requests go through the Hatchline gateway, so you'll need auth on every call. Use the shared support key below for read-only access.

app token of yajeg-kawef = kto11_7En3XSX8xQw

Postmortem timeline — Blinkerbot outage

14:22 — Blinkerbot stopped answering deploy-status queries in the Fernwell workspace. Plugin hooks were still firing, so third-party commands looked fine, but core status lookups silently returned stale data. We traced it to a cache shim that shipped in the morning rollout. The offending build is identified by the token below.

trace token, faduf-hahig: htk4_b8f9